
LODI, N.J. - - The Wilmington University bowling team went 3-5 in the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ference Meet No. 2 this weekend, hosted by Felician at the Lodi Lanes.
Combining the two CACC Regular Season Meets, the Wildcats went 10-8 in head-to-head matchups, qualifying and earning the No. 3 seed in the upcoming CACC Championships.
The Wildcats competed in four traditional matches on Saturday, going 1-4 overall. They dropped their first match to Dominican, 909-854, before winning out of the bye, 733-728, against Holy Family. Saturday ended with losses to Felician, 877-805, and Caldwell, 901-757.
Sydney Jones led the Wildcats on Saturday with a four-match total of 730, bowling a 182.50 average. She finished fourth overall. Jones came out of the gates strong with a 246 against Dominican. She also bowled a 225 against Felician.
Logan Brown finished sixth overall with a 179.75 average, finishing with a 719 total pinfall. She had a day's high 197 against Caldwell in the final game while also bowling a 180 against Dominican and a 179 against Felician.
Genna Closs finished 16th overall with a 660 total pinfall, good enough for a 165.00 average. She bowled a 181 against Dominican and had a 168 against Felician.
Miranda Dudas placed 18th overall with a four-match total of 629 for a 157.25 average. She had a day's best 184 against Caldwell while adding a 156 against Holy Family.
Alexa Pacheco finished 23rd overall with a 102.75 average, finishing with a 411 total pinfall. She had a day's best 114 against Holy Family.
The tournament shifted to Baker matches on Sunday and the Wildcats went 2-2 overall. The day started with a day's best 932 team score against Felician, defeating the Golden Falcons, 932-871. They also defeated Holy Family, 744-681, for their second win of the day before falling to Dominican, 908-769, and Caldwell, 851-824.
Felician will be the No. 1 seed in the upcoming CACC Championship with a 14-4 head-to-head record in the two meets. Caldwell will be the No. 2 seed with a 13-5 head-to-head record. The Wildcats are third at 10-8 while Dominican rounds out the Championships with the No. 4 spot with a 9-9 record.
The CACC Championships will take place starting on Friday, March 21 at Pike Lanes in Southampton, Pennsylvania. The Wildcats have one final tune-up prior to the CACC Championships though, hosting the Northeast Roundup at Bowlerama. The two-day tournament begins on Saturday, March 15.
